St Petersburg bakes in hottest April day since 1920

St. Petersburg broke a temperature record that had stood for 105 years. The city reached 21.9 degrees Celsius by 4:00 p.m. Wednesday, matching the daily high set back in 1920. Temperatures continued climbing to 22.5 degrees just an hour later, shattering the century-old mark, according to Mikhail Leus from the Phobos weather center.

Alexander Kolesov, who heads the St. Petersburg Hydrometeorological Center, said readings might rise another few tenths of a degree. Officials will announce the final maximum temperature later in the evening. April 16 became the warmest day St. Petersburg has experienced since the start of 2025.

Weather forecasters have already released predictions for upcoming Easter celebrations and May holidays. The unusual warmth surprised many residents who enjoyed outdoor activities throughout the day. Previous warm weather this month never reached these exceptional levels despite being above normal for April.
